SS(Shadowsocks)是一個開源的加密代理工具,被廣泛用于穿越防火墻的網絡加速和翻墻工作。它通過將網絡流量加密并分散在多個節點上,實現了更安全和更低延遲的網絡連接。
搭建SS非常簡單。
首先,我們需要一臺位于境外的虛擬私有服務器(VPS)。大多數人選擇將服務器托管在一些知名的云服務提供商上,如亞馬遜AWS、谷歌云平臺或DigitalOcean等。一旦我們獲得了VPS的登錄憑證,我們就可以開始配置SS了。
第二步是在VPS上安裝Shadowsocks服務器軟件。我們可以選擇使用Python版本的Shadowsocks,也可以選擇其他語言的版本。在終端中輸入命令"pip install shadowsocks",即可輕松安裝。然后,我們需要創建一個配置文件,指定服務器的IP地址、端口號、密碼和加密方式等。配置文件的格式通常為JSON格式,如下所示:
{
"server":"0.0.0.0",
"server_port":8388,
"password":"mypassword",
"method":"aes-256-cfb",
"timeout":300
}
其中,server字段是VPS的IP地址,server_port字段是服務器監聽的端口號,password字段是連接服務器所需的密碼,method字段是加密方式,timeout字段是超時時間。我們可以根據自己的需要進行修改。
配置文件創建好后,我們可以使用命令"ssserver -c /path/to/config.json"啟動Shadowsocks服務器。如果一切順利,服務器將開始監聽指定的端口,并等待客戶端的連接請求。
第三步是在我們需要翻墻的設備上安裝和配置Shadowsocks客戶端。Shadowsocks有多個平臺的客戶端可供選擇,如Windows、Mac、iOS和Android等。我們只需下載并安裝相應平臺的客戶端,并將服務器的IP地址、端口號、密碼和加密方式等信息填入配置頁面即可。
一旦客戶端配置完成并連接到服務器,我們就可以自由地瀏覽被防火墻屏蔽的網站和服務了。SS不僅能夠加速網絡連接,還可以保護用戶的隱私和數據安全。它通過加密傳輸的數據,使得黑客或監控者無法輕易竊取或篡改用戶的信息。
然而,需要注意的是,使用SS進行翻墻可能違反了某些國家或地區的法律法規。在使用SS時,我們應該遵守當地的法律規定,并且明確自己所處的使用環境。此外,除非我們對搭建和維護SS有足夠的技術知識,否則最好選擇一些受信任的SS服務提供商,以避免被不法分子利用。
總之,SS是一種實用而靈活的工具,可以幫助用戶穿越防火墻和加速網絡連接。搭建SS相對簡單,但使用時應該合法合規,并注意保護個人隱私和數據安全。